Product Overview

The PC28F00AP30BFA is a 1Gbit (128MB) industrial parallel NOR Flash by Micron in 64-EasyBGA package. It supports 16-bit parallel asynchronous and synchronous dual interface with up to 52MHz synchronous read speed. It supports XIP (execute-in-place) to run firmware directly without RAM copying. Equipped with independent boot parameter blocks, main storage blocks, one-time programmable OTP memory, block locking and password anti-tampering mechanisms, it provides high reliability and security for industrial firmware booting.

Specifications

Capacity: 1Gbit / 128MB (64M×16bit) Interface: 16-bit parallel NOR, 52MHz synchronous read / 100ns asynchronous access Power Supply: Core 1.7V~2.0V, IO 1.7V~3.6V Package: 64-EasyBGA (8×10mm) Temperature: -40℃~+85℃ industrial grade Endurance: 100,000 cycles per block Data Retention: 10 years at 85℃ high temperature Architecture: 4×32KB boot parameter blocks + multiple 128KB main data blocks Security: 64-bit factory OTP, 2112-bit user OTP, password block lock anti-tampering Features: Program/erase suspend, independent block lock, permanent block protection

Key Features

Native XIP function allows MCU/FPGA to execute firmware directly from Flash without RAM copying, simplifying boot architecture Independent boot block and main block partition ensures safe firmware upgrade and partition isolation Hardware block lock and password protection prevent firmware tampering, reverse engineering and illegal upgrading High-speed synchronous read significantly reduces system boot time Erase/program suspend mechanism prioritizes read access and improves system real-time performance

Typical Applications

Firmware storage and booting for industrial switches, routers and embedded gateways High-reliability OS image storage for vehicle control units and medical devices Bootloader and main program partition storage for power protection and communication base station equipment Industrial core devices requiring anti-tampering, high stability and long service life ---
